BASKING RIDGE, NJ - Verizon Business Markets has launched the Software Defined Secure Branch solution for businesses with multiple locations, state and local governments, and educational institutions.

Software Defined Secure Branch is designed for businesses and organizations with complex IT management needs and the desire for more visibility, security protection, and control of their network. Once in place, it keeps the network secure and accessible through a combination of simplified management, the intuitive software defined wide area network (SD-WAN) solution, and security.

“Software Defined Secure Branch lets our customers focus on their business or organization as first priority, leaving the IT to us,” said Victoria Lonker, Verizon’s vice president of global products and solutions. “The simple, intuitive experience delivers rapid provisioning, a mobile management app, service health, application visibility and the security controls needed to protect the business.”

Software Defined Secure Branch, offered with Versa Networks, provides:

  • Improved collaboration, video and cloud-based service performance leveraging SD-WAN to automatically adapt the network for improved application performance.
  • Business continuity benefits through enterprise-grade connectivity and Verizon’s robust 4G LTE network for active backup.
  • Bundled security through Verizon’s comprehensive threat management and end-to-end network encryption.
  • An application-centric network on Verizon’s sophisticated and managed infrastructure for enhanced user experience.
  • Intuitive mobile app-based service management and continuous monitoring capabilities for the service.

The service is easily accessible through the Verizon Enterprise Center online user experience portal that unifies the purchase, deployment, and management. The visibility provided through the portal gives business owners the tools needed to deliver on a better customer experience.

“SD-WAN is a powerful and complex solution with many moving parts. Verizon’s new offer is a simple yet flexible way for businesses and partners to get technology at the level of features they need, and expand into new features as they need them,” said Brian Washburn, Practice Leader, Network Transformation and Cloud, Ovum.
